Key Activities and Applications
- Integrated Property Management (PMS) deployment — centralizing reservations, housekeeping, billing, and accounting into cloud platforms to create single sources of truth for operations and finance.
- AI-enabled Revenue Management — end-to-end RMS that ingests market signals, channel mix and guest profiles to set dynamic rates and ancillary offers in real time.
- Channel and Booking Engine Optimization — unified channel managers and Internet Booking Engines (IBE) that reduce OTA commissions by increasing direct conversions and synchronizing availability across OTAs, GDS and direct channels.
- Contactless guest journey and mobile guest services — mobile check-in/out, mobile keys, and AI chat for service requests to reduce front-desk labor and speed throughput.
- Data-driven labor scheduling and housekeeping automation — predictive rostering and task assignment that reduce payroll share of revenue while improving on-room readiness.
Emergent Trends and Core Insights
- Personalization as revenue lever — properties that integrate guest profiles with pricing engines can see meaningful revenue lifts; AI personalization initiatives are reported to drive up to 30% incremental uplift in targeted cases Amadeus report: 6 key travel trends for 2026 and are central to capturing higher ADRs The Next Big Things in Hospitality: Trends for 2025.
- Remote-work and long-stay segmentation — the "workcation" and digital-nomad guest mixes are durable; surveys show 58% of business travelers blend leisure and work and extended stays (14+ nights) deliver 27% higher revenue per occupied room for properties that package workspace facilities Best 30 hotel industry trends you must know in 2025 Top Trends Shaping the Hospitality Industry in 2025.
- Cloud-first platformization — cloud deployments dominate purchasing decisions for scale and multi-property control; the hospitality PMS market is expanding in value and cloud share as operators prefer remote, managed architectures Hospitality Property Management Software Market 2025.
- Operational cost squeeze — operating expenses (insurance, labor) are rising faster than base revenues in many markets, making efficiency tech (RMS, staff tasking, self-service) a financial necessity rather than optional innovation Hotel Industry Trends & Benchmarking - CBRE Hotels.
> Investments will favor software that produces measurable NOI uplift per room and demonstrable payroll or energy savings rather than feature lists.
Technologies and Methodologies
- AI / ML for demand forecasting and dynamic pricing — core to modern RMS offerings; adoption correlates with measurable ADR and RevPAR gains when tied to guest segmentation.
- Cloud-native PMS + Open APIs — enabling multi-property management, two-way OTA integrations, and marketplaces of third-party services for upsells and guest engagement.
- Connected-hotel IoT and building automation — occupancy sensors, smart HVAC, and lighting integrated into PMS/CMMS workflows to cut energy spend and support green reporting that increasingly matters to investors Connected Hotel System and Solution Market Research Report.
- Contactless and mobile guest tech — digital registration, mobile keys, and unified guest messaging reduce touchpoints and labor while increasing conversion from direct channels.
- Business Intelligence (BI) & decision automation — consolidated dashboards that synthesize operational, market, and channel data to execute automated price and inventory strategies across portfolios.

Executive Summary
Hotel operators face a clear choice: treat software adoption as hygiene and concentrate commercial effort on extracting measurable NOI improvements, or risk margin erosion as operating costs rise. The most immediate revenue opportunities come from integrating AI pricing, direct-booking engines, and contactless guest journeys while repurposing staff toward high-value service. Investors and owners should prioritize platform partners that demonstrate rapid time to financial impact (measured in RevPAR and payroll share improvements) and that provide open APIs for ecosystem expansion. Talent pipelines and specialized operational playbooks will determine which management firms convert technology into durable asset uplift.
